Forza Horizon Play Through

  • Thread starter Thread starter Tunervillage
  • 1 comments
  • 2,005 views
Messages
24
United States
United States
I've decided to play through the the first game in Forza's spin off series Forza Horizon. Check it out I'll be posting updates.









 
Last edited:
Back